Heim >Backend-Entwicklung >PHP-Tutorial >Lernkurve und Entwicklererfahrung von Slim und Phalcon

Lernkurve und Entwicklererfahrung von Slim und Phalcon

WBOY
WBOYOriginal
2024-06-01 11:49:57581Durchsuche

Lern- und Erfahrungsunterschiede zwischen Slim und Phalcon: Lernkurve: Slim ist leicht zu erlernen und für Anfänger geeignet, während Phalcon steiler und für erfahrene Entwickler geeignet ist. Entwicklererfahrung: Slim ist flexibel und ermöglicht Benutzern das Entwerfen von Anwendungen, während Phalcon der MVC-Architektur folgt und Komponenten und Funktionen für einen schnellen Start bereitstellt. Praktischer Fall: Für eine einfache Blog-Anwendung ist Slim einfach einzurichten, erfordert jedoch eine separate Verarbeitung der Datenbank, während Phalcon ORM und View Engine bereitstellt, um die Entwicklung zu vereinfachen.

Lernkurve und Entwicklererfahrung von Slim und Phalcon

Slim vs. Phalcon: Lernkurve und Entwicklererfahrung

Slim und Phalcon sind zwei beliebte PHP-Frameworks, die unterschiedliche Lernkurven und Entwicklererfahrungen aufweisen. Es ist wichtig, ihre Unterschiede zu verstehen, damit Sie diejenige auswählen können, die Ihren Projektanforderungen am besten entspricht.

Lernkurve

  • Slim: Slim ist bekannt für sein geringes Gewicht und seinen Minimalismus. Es hat eine sanfte Lernkurve und ist perfekt für unerfahrene PHP-Entwickler.
  • Phalcon: Phalcon ist ein funktionsreiches Framework, das viele Funktionen sofort bereitstellt. Die Lernkurve ist steiler als bei Slim, aber es kann erfahrenen Entwicklern eine bessere Leistung bieten.

Entwicklererfahrung

  • Slim: Slim ist ein sehr flexibles Framework, mit dem Sie problemlos benutzerdefinierte Anwendungen erstellen können. Es erzwingt keine bestimmte Architektur, sodass Sie beim Design Ihrer Anwendung völlige Freiheit haben.
  • Phalcon: Phalcon folgt der Model-View-Controller (MVC)-Architektur, die eine klare Struktur bietet. Es bietet außerdem eine Fülle integrierter Komponenten, die Ihnen den schnellen Einstieg erleichtern.

Praktisches Beispiel

Betrachten wir eine einfache Blogging-Anwendung.

  • Slim: Mit Slim können Sie ganz einfach Routen einrichten, Anfragen bearbeiten und Ansichten rendern. Sie müssen Datenbankverbindungen und Abfragen separat behandeln.
  • Phalcon: Phalcon bietet einen ORM (Object Relational Mapper), mit dem Sie Datenbankinteraktionen einfach verwalten können. Es bietet außerdem eine integrierte Ansichts-Engine, die das Rendern von Ansichten vereinfacht.

Fazit

Slim und Phalcon bieten unterschiedliche Lernkurven und Entwicklererfahrungen. Für leichte, flexible Anwendungen ist Slim eine gute Wahl. Für komplexe Anwendungen, die eine bessere Leistung und integrierte Funktionen erfordern, ist Phalcon die bessere Wahl.

Das obige ist der detaillierte Inhalt vonLernkurve und Entwicklererfahrung von Slim und Phalcon.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n